带蒂胸外侧动脉穿支皮瓣在保乳术后即刻乳房重建中的临床应用

摘要: 目的 探讨带蒂胸外侧动脉穿支皮瓣在乳腺癌保乳术后一期乳房重建中的应用效果及其肿瘤安全性。方法 纳入2020年10月至2022年5月收治的41例以胸外侧动脉穿支皮瓣行保乳整形的乳腺癌患者,年龄35~82岁,平均56.4岁,均为女性。肿瘤均为单侧,左侧15例,右侧26例;肿瘤位于外上象限21例,外下象限6例,内上象限9例,内下象限3例,乳头后方2例;肿瘤直径0.9~4.0 cm;luminal A型14例,luminal B型17例,HER2过表达型7例,三阴型3例;Ⅰ期肿瘤19例,Ⅱ期肿瘤16例,Ⅲ期肿瘤6例。术后短期观察皮瓣成活情况及重建后的乳房外形。所有患者均行肿瘤综合治疗,随访原发病灶局部复发情况。结果 41例患者切除肿瘤及乳腺组织质量平均约40 g。术后随访3~24个月,平均12个月。所有皮瓣均成活。放疗后皮瓣体积无缩小,重建乳房外形满意。所有患者均未出现乳腺癌局部复发。结论 带蒂胸外侧动脉穿支皮瓣是操作相对简单、可重复性强的肿瘤整形技术,可极大改善保乳后乳房外形,值得临床推广应用。

Abstract: Objective To investigate the clinical application effect of the pedicled lateral thoracic artery perforator flap in breast reconstruction after breast conserving surgery and its tumor safety. Methods A total of 41 breast cancer patients who underwent breast-conserving surgery using pedicled lateral thoracic artery perforator flap from October 2020 to May 2022 were included in the study. Age ranged from 35 to 82 years old, 56.4 years on average. All the paitents were females. The tumors were all unilateral, with 15 cases on the left and 26 cases on the right side. The locations of the masses were the out upper lateral quadrant (n=21), the outer lower quadrant (n=6), the inner upper quadrant (n=9), the inner lower quadrant (n=3), and the posterior nipple (n=2). The diameter ranged from 0.9 cm to 4.0 cm. There were luminal A type (n=14), luminal B type (n=17), HER2 overexpression type (n=7), and triple negative type (n=3); There were 19 cases in stage Ⅰ, 16 cases in stage Ⅱ, and 6 cases in stage Ⅲ. Survival of the flap, the shape of the reconstructed breast and the local recurrence were observed after operation. Results The average mass of tumor and breast tissue resected was about 40 g. All flaps survived. There was no reduction in flap volume after radiotherapy. All 41 patients were followed up for 3 to 24 months (12 months on average) with satisfactory results. No recurrence of breast cancer happened. Conclusion The pedicled lateral thoracic artery perforator flap is a relatively simple and reproducible reconstructive technique, which greatly improves the breast shape after breast conserving, and is worthy of clinical application and promotion.
